Key Features to Look For

Picking a camera can be tricky. Knowing what to look for makes it easier.

1. Image Quality: Pixels and Sensors
  • Megapixels (MP): More megapixels mean bigger pictures. You can print them large! Most vacation cameras need at least 12 MP.
  • Sensor Size: A bigger sensor catches more light. This means better pictures in low light. Look for a 1-inch sensor or larger for great results.
2. Zoom Power
  • Optical Zoom: Optical zoom uses lenses to get closer. It won’t make your pictures blurry! Choose a camera with at least 10x optical zoom.
  • Digital Zoom: Digital zoom crops the image. It can make your pictures look grainy. Try to avoid relying on digital zoom.
3. Video Capabilities
  • Video Resolution: Look for cameras that shoot in at least 1080p (Full HD). Some cameras shoot in 4K!
  • Frame Rate: A higher frame rate means smoother videos. A frame rate of 30fps (frames per second) is good.
4. Durability
  • Water Resistance: Will you be near water? Get a waterproof camera!
  • Shock Resistance: Accidentally drop your camera? A shock-resistant camera will survive.
  • Dust Resistance: Protect your camera from sand and dust.
5. Connectivity
  • Wi-Fi and Bluetooth: These let you share photos and videos easily. You can send them to your phone or tablet.
  • GPS: GPS tags your photos with location data.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Several things affect how good your pictures are.

What Makes a Camera Great?
  • Good Lenses: High-quality lenses are the most important thing. They capture clear, sharp images.
  • Image Stabilization: This helps prevent blurry pictures when your hands shake. Look for cameras with image stabilization.
  • Fast Autofocus: Fast autofocus means your camera quickly focuses on your subject.
  • Battery Life: A camera with long battery life is important. You don’t want to miss a shot!
What Hurts Image Quality?
  • Cheap Lenses: They often produce blurry pictures.
  • Small Sensors: They struggle in low light.
  • Poor Image Stabilization: This causes shaky pictures.
  • Slow Autofocus: You might miss the perfect moment.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about how you will use your camera.

  • Point-and-Shoot Cameras: These are easy to use. They are great for beginners.
  • Mirrorless Cameras: These offer better image quality. They are smaller than DSLRs.
  • Action Cameras: These are tough and waterproof. They are perfect for adventure trips.

Consider where you go on vacation. A waterproof camera is great for the beach. A camera with a long zoom is great for wildlife.
